This section describes the PLEX-ID SP control panel and internal
software.
The keyboard is shown in Figure 4–30.
Figure 4–30.
Keyboard of the PLEX-ID SP
The relevant keys and control buttons are described in detail below.
The arrow keys are used to select the next protocol and to navigate in
the display.
To accept the selection.
To initiate the run.
To confirm a performed step in the protocol, for example, plate
loading or removal.
To pause/terminate the processing step. In short:
STOP
(paused)/
START
(the instrument continues after a Pause step)
STOP
(paused)/
STOP
(the processing is terminated).
To pause the run. It will pause at the end of the ongoing processing
step.
